Threat hunting is no easy task. Security analyst most pore through scores of data and threat intelligence and use their own familiarity with the network to create hypotheses about potential attacks and exploits.
Fortunately, advancements in technology, strategy, intel-sharing and automation have improved our ability to continuously seek out indicators of compromise and proactively root out malicious actors before they can do damage. And it’s none too soon, especially in an uncertain time when foreign adversaries are threatening our critical infrastructure and private industry.
